They're so yummy with the sticky rice.I made these for my dinner.Strong aroma of the black pepper,coriander roots and lemongrass will make you feel hungry.You can enjoy them as the appetizer along with cold beer as well.They're such a great combination!!
Ingredients and spices that need to be Take to make Thai Grilled Chicken Wings with Black Pepper and Lemongrass:
- 7 pieces chicken wings
- 2 stalks chopped lemongrass
- 1 tablespoon black pepper
- 3 coriander roots
- 4 cloves garlic
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 2 teaspoons fish sauce
- 2 teaspoons oyster sauce
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- coriander leaves for garnish
Steps to make to make Thai Grilled Chicken Wings with Black Pepper and Lemongrass
- Pound or blend the garlic cloves,coriander roots and black pepper with mortar or food processor until combine.Then put chopped lemongrass into the mixture and blend them together.
- Pierce the chicken wings with a fork or knife evenly to make them absorb the seasoning better.Put the blended mixture on the chicken along with all seasonings above.Mix them with the chicken and marinate at least 20 mins in the fridge.
- Put the chicken on the BBQ stove and grilled on low heat until they're cooked or grill them in the oven at 200 C. for 15 mins until golden brown.
- Put them on the plates and serve along with coriander leaves.
